随着互联网技术的飞速发展,智能零售系统逐渐成为零售行业的新趋势。为了应对日益复杂的业务场景,提高系统的稳定性和效率,分布式追踪技术应运而生。本文将探讨分布式追踪技巧在智能零售系统中的应用,以及如何推动智能零售系统的变革。

一、分布式追踪技术概述

分布式追踪技术是指通过追踪分布式系统中各个组件之间的调用关系,实现对系统性能、故障定位、业务分析等方面的监控。其主要目的是解决分布式系统中由于网络延迟、组件依赖等因素导致的性能瓶颈和故障定位困难等问题。

二、分布式追踪在智能零售系统中的应用

  1. 提高系统稳定性

在智能零售系统中,分布式追踪技术可以帮助开发者实时监控系统的运行状态,快速定位故障点。当系统出现异常时,分布式追踪技术能够快速定位到故障组件,从而降低故障排查时间,提高系统稳定性。


  1. 优化系统性能

通过分布式追踪,开发者可以实时了解系统各个组件的调用关系和性能指标。针对性能瓶颈,可以针对性地进行优化,如调整系统架构、优化数据库查询、提升缓存命中率等。这将有助于提高智能零售系统的整体性能。


  1. 促进业务分析

分布式追踪技术能够收集系统运行过程中的大量数据,包括调用链路、性能指标、业务数据等。通过对这些数据的分析,可以深入了解用户行为、业务流程,为优化产品、提升用户体验提供有力支持。


  1. 提升开发效率

在智能零售系统中,分布式追踪技术有助于开发者快速定位问题,减少排查时间。此外,分布式追踪工具通常提供可视化界面,方便开发者直观地了解系统运行状态,从而提高开发效率。

三、推动智能零售系统变革

  1. 引入微服务架构

微服务架构是分布式系统的一种设计模式,将系统拆分为多个独立的服务,每个服务负责特定的功能。通过分布式追踪技术,可以轻松实现微服务架构下的系统监控、性能优化和业务分析。


  1. 深化数据驱动决策

分布式追踪技术能够收集大量系统运行数据,为业务决策提供有力支持。通过分析这些数据,可以深入了解用户需求,优化产品功能,提升用户体验。


  1. 推动技术创新

分布式追踪技术在智能零售系统中的应用,将推动相关技术的创新,如大数据、人工智能等。这些技术的融合将进一步提升智能零售系统的智能化水平。


  1. 优化供应链管理

智能零售系统在供应链管理方面的应用日益广泛。通过分布式追踪技术,可以实时监控供应链各个环节,提高供应链的透明度和效率。

四、总结

分布式追踪技术在智能零售系统中的应用具有重要意义。它有助于提高系统稳定性、优化性能、促进业务分析,推动智能零售系统的变革。随着技术的不断发展,分布式追踪技术将在智能零售领域发挥更大的作用。